Contracts Manager - #1102509
ASA Contracts

Key responsibilities:
· Oversee full spectrum of contracts administration and quantity surveying duties from pre- to post-contract.
· Maintain accurate and organized records of all contracts, correspondence, and contract-related documentation.
· Track key contractual obligations, deliverables, timelines, and milestones.
· Administer and manage contracts including progress payments, variations, claims, final accounts, and contractual correspondences.
· Monitor project costs, track changes, and produce cost reports for management review.
· Liaise with project teams, consultants, and clients to resolve contractual issues and disputes.
· Ensure compliance with company procedures, contract terms, and statutory requirements.
· Mentor junior QS team members and assist in department development.
Job Requirements:
· Degree or Diploma in Quantity Surveying, Building, Construction Management, or related disciplines.
· Minimum 5 years of relevant experience with a Senior or Managerial role in handling contractual issues in the Construction industry.
· Proven track record in handling medium to large-scale or public projects.
· Strong negotiation, analytical, and communication skills.
· Proficient in MS Office (Word, Excel, Project).
· Team player with a proactive and hands-on attitude.
· Able to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ines.
